    Emphatic Do: What It Is and How to Use It in English Sentences explains an important but often confusing grammar concept in simple and clear language. The emphatic do is used to add stress or emphasis to a verb, especially when we want to show strong feelings, correct someone, or make our point clearer. Many English learners hear native speakers say sentences like “I do understand” or “She does work hard” but are unsure why do is used. This topic breaks down the meaning, structure, and correct usage of emphatic do with easy examples and common situations.     Many English learners feel confused about the difference between shall and will because both are used to talk about the future. While will is commonly used in modern English, shall still appears in formal writing, legal language, and polite suggestions. Understanding when and how to use shall and will correctly can improve your grammar, speaking confidence, and writing accuracy.
